Engro Fertilizer’s profit up 47 percent

byCT Report
17/08/2017
in Business
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

ISLAMABAD: Profit of Engro Fertilizers Limited (EFERT) surged 47 percent to Rs4.102 billion for the half-year ended June 30, translating into earnings per share (EPS) of Rs3.07.

The EFERT recorded a profit of Rs2.793 billion and EPS of Rs2.1 during the same period a year ago, a press statement said.  Engro Fertilizer also announced an interim dividend of Rs2.5/share.  The company’s sales revenue rose 22 percent during the half year ended June 30, to Rs27.31 billion over the last year’s period.  The other income of EFERT income also rose a massive 58 percent to Rs3.274 billion on the back of higher subsidy recognition of urea and diammonium phosphate.
